Best thing to learn is to water by weight but for now you can burry your 2nd knuckle in, do you feel mosture? If you do then donāt water, doesnāt have to be damp just needs mosture. Dry wet cylce is good for the roots to stretch.
Very very easy to over wster in the first 2 weeks.

A gallon of water properly applied to a 5 gal pot of bone dry dirt is just barely going to make it moist.
If you only spray a three inch circle around the base of the plant what do you think the roots do?
It would cause the roots to not search for water as far right? Going forward iāll just water with about 4oz per plant and start from the edge of the pot in order to help the roots look for the water.
That is correct. As a matter of fact if you were to just spray a little on the top everyday the roots will grow up to meet it.
